Transaction 245919ae814a9c92670c2c1d63454200e4d3918ce57f40925e5e6c8576c32b33
1 Input
1 Output
-
245919ae814a9c92670c2c1d63454200e4d3918ce57f40925e5e6c8576c32b33:0
- value
- 17313607
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b4d9cb8af5e33d112c64be9a50b6bb513bd76d51 OP_EQUAL
- address
- 3JBGTjx35Hdn2kKvfes5V5ZSGTa822vpfk